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es a warm, nonjudgmental therapeutic relationship in which the client’s perspective guides the work. This approach helps people gain insight, build self-esteem and make choices that align with their values.

Mindfulness Therapy teaches present-focused awareness and simple practices to reduce stress and manage anxiety symptoms. It can help clients develop calmer responses to difficult thoughts and emotions.

Solution-Focused Therapy is a short-term, goal-oriented method that concentrates on identifying practical steps and strengths to move forward. It is useful when clients want focused progress on specific issues or challenges.
